import boto
from sure import expect
from moto import mock_swf
from moto.swf.exceptions import (
SWFUnknownResourceFault,
SWFTypeAlreadyExistsFault,
SWFTypeDeprecatedFault,
SWFSerializationException,
)
# RegisterActivityType endpoint
@mock_swf
def test_register_activity_type():
conn = boto.connect_swf("the_key", "the_secret")
conn.register_domain("test-domain", "60")
conn.register_activity_type("test-domain", "test-activity", "v1.0")
types = conn.list_activity_types("test-domain", "REGISTERED")
actype = types["typeInfos"][0]
actype["activityType"]["name"].should.equal("test-activity")
actype["activityType"]["version"].should.equal("v1.0")
@mock_swf
def test_register_already_existing_activity_type():
conn = boto.connect_swf("the_key", "the_secret")
conn.register_domain("test-domain", "60")
conn.register_activity_type("test-domain", "test-activity", "v1.0")
conn.register_activity_type.when.called_with(
"test-domain", "test-activity", "v1.0"
).should.throw(SWFTypeAlreadyExistsFault)
@mock_swf
def test_register_with_wrong_parameter_type():
conn = boto.connect_swf("the_key", "the_secret")
conn.register_domain("test-domain", "60")
conn.register_activity_type.when.called_with(
"test-domain", "test-activity", 12
).should.throw(SWFSerializationException)
# ListActivityTypes endpoint
@mock_swf
def test_list_activity_types():
conn = boto.connect_swf("the_key", "the_secret")
conn.register_domain("test-domain", "60")
conn.register_activity_type("test-domain", "b-test-activity", "v1.0")
conn.register_activity_type("test-domain", "a-test-activity", "v1.0")
conn.register_activity_type("test-domain", "c-test-activity", "v1.0")
all_activity_types = conn.list_activity_types("test-domain", "REGISTERED")
names = [activity_type["activityType"]["name"] for activity_type in all_activity_types["typeInfos"]]
names.should.equal(["a-test-activity", "b-test-activity", "c-test-activity"])
@mock_swf
def test_list_activity_types_reverse_order():
conn = boto.connect_swf("the_key", "the_secret")
conn.register_domain("test-domain", "60")
conn.register_activity_type("test-domain", "b-test-activity", "v1.0")
conn.register_activity_type("test-domain", "a-test-activity", "v1.0")
conn.register_activity_type("test-domain", "c-test-activity", "v1.0")
all_activity_types = conn.list_activity_types("test-domain", "REGISTERED",
reverse_order=True)
names = [activity_type["activityType"]["name"] for activity_type in all_activity_types["typeInfos"]]
names.should.equal(["c-test-activity", "b-test-activity", "a-test-activity"])
# DeprecateActivityType endpoint
@mock_swf
def test_deprecate_activity_type():
conn = boto.connect_swf("the_key", "the_secret")
conn.register_domain("test-domain", "60")
conn.register_activity_type("test-domain", "test-activity", "v1.0")
conn.deprecate_activity_type("test-domain", "test-activity", "v1.0")
actypes = conn.list_activity_types("test-domain", "DEPRECATED")
actype = actypes["typeInfos"][0]
actype["activityType"]["name"].should.equal("test-activity")
actype["activityType"]["version"].should.equal("v1.0")
@mock_swf
def test_deprecate_already_deprecated_activity_type():
conn = boto.connect_swf("the_key", "the_secret")
conn.register_domain("test-domain", "60")
conn.register_activity_type("test-domain", "test-activity", "v1.0")
conn.deprecate_activity_type("test-domain", "test-activity", "v1.0")
conn.deprecate_activity_type.when.called_with(
"test-domain", "test-activity", "v1.0"
).should.throw(SWFTypeDeprecatedFault)
@mock_swf
def test_deprecate_non_existent_activity_type():
conn = boto.connect_swf("the_key", "the_secret")
conn.register_domain("test-domain", "60")
conn.deprecate_activity_type.when.called_with(
"test-domain", "non-existent", "v1.0"
).should.throw(SWFUnknownResourceFault)
# DescribeActivityType endpoint
@mock_swf
def test_describe_activity_type():
conn = boto.connect_swf("the_key", "the_secret")
conn.register_domain("test-domain", "60")
conn.register_activity_type("test-domain", "test-activity", "v1.0",
task_list="foo", default_task_heartbeat_timeout="32")
actype = conn.describe_activity_type("test-domain", "test-activity", "v1.0")
actype["configuration"]["defaultTaskList"]["name"].should.equal("foo")
infos = actype["typeInfo"]
infos["activityType"]["name"].should.equal("test-activity")
infos["activityType"]["version"].should.equal("v1.0")
infos["status"].should.equal("REGISTERED")
@mock_swf
def test_describe_non_existent_activity_type():
conn = boto.connect_swf("the_key", "the_secret")
conn.register_domain("test-domain", "60")
conn.describe_activity_type.when.called_with(
"test-domain", "non-existent", "v1.0"
).should.throw(SWFUnknownResourceFault)

import boto
from sure import expect
from moto import mock_swf
from moto.swf import swf_backend
from moto.swf.exceptions import (
SWFUnknownResourceFault,
SWFValidationException,
SWFDecisionValidationException,
)
from ..utils import mock_basic_workflow_type
@mock_swf
def setup_workflow():
conn = boto.connect_swf("the_key", "the_secret")
conn.register_domain("test-domain", "60", description="A test domain")
conn = mock_basic_workflow_type("test-domain", conn)
conn.register_activity_type(
"test-domain", "test-activity", "v1.1",
default_task_heartbeat_timeout="600",
default_task_schedule_to_close_timeout="600",
default_task_schedule_to_start_timeout="600",
default_task_start_to_close_timeout="600",
)
wfe = conn.start_workflow_execution("test-domain", "uid-abcd1234", "test-workflow", "v1.0")
conn.run_id = wfe["runId"]
return conn
# PollForDecisionTask endpoint
@mock_swf
def test_poll_for_decision_task_when_one():
conn = setup_workflow()
resp = conn.get_workflow_execution_history("test-domain", conn.run_id, "uid-abcd1234")
types = [evt["eventType"] for evt in resp["events"]]
types.should.equal(["WorkflowExecutionStarted", "DecisionTaskScheduled"])
resp = conn.poll_for_decision_task("test-domain", "queue", identity="srv01")
types = [evt["eventType"] for evt in resp["events"]]
types.should.equal(["WorkflowExecutionStarted", "DecisionTaskScheduled", "DecisionTaskStarted"])
resp["events"][-1]["decisionTaskStartedEventAttributes"]["identity"].should.equal("srv01")
@mock_swf
def test_poll_for_decision_task_when_none():
conn = setup_workflow()
conn.poll_for_decision_task("test-domain", "queue")
resp = conn.poll_for_decision_task("test-domain", "queue")
# this is the DecisionTask representation you get from the real SWF
# after waiting 60s when there's no decision to be taken
resp.should.equal({"previousStartedEventId": 0, "startedEventId": 0})
@mock_swf
def test_poll_for_decision_task_on_non_existent_queue():
conn = setup_workflow()
resp = conn.poll_for_decision_task("test-domain", "non-existent-queue")
resp.should.equal({"previousStartedEventId": 0, "startedEventId": 0})
@mock_swf
def test_poll_for_decision_task_with_reverse_order():
conn = setup_workflow()
resp = conn.poll_for_decision_task("test-domain", "queue", reverse_order=True)
types = [evt["eventType"] for evt in resp["events"]]
types.should.equal(["DecisionTaskStarted", "DecisionTaskScheduled", "WorkflowExecutionStarted"])
# CountPendingDecisionTasks endpoint
@mock_swf
def test_count_pending_decision_tasks():
conn = setup_workflow()
conn.poll_for_decision_task("test-domain", "queue")
resp = conn.count_pending_decision_tasks("test-domain", "queue")
resp.should.equal({"count": 1, "truncated": False})
@mock_swf
def test_count_pending_decision_tasks_on_non_existent_task_list():
conn = setup_workflow()
resp = conn.count_pending_decision_tasks("test-domain", "non-existent")
resp.should.equal({"count": 0, "truncated": False})
@mock_swf
def test_count_pending_decision_tasks_after_decision_completes():
conn = setup_workflow()
resp = conn.poll_for_decision_task("test-domain", "queue")
conn.respond_decision_task_completed(resp["taskToken"])
resp = conn.count_pending_decision_tasks("test-domain", "queue")
resp.should.equal({"count": 0, "truncated": False})
# RespondDecisionTaskCompleted endpoint
@mock_swf
def test_respond_decision_task_completed_with_no_decision():
conn = setup_workflow()
resp = conn.poll_for_decision_task("test-domain", "queue")
task_token = resp["taskToken"]
resp = conn.respond_decision_task_completed(task_token)
resp.should.be.none
resp = conn.get_workflow_execution_history("test-domain", conn.run_id, "uid-abcd1234")
types = [evt["eventType"] for evt in resp["events"]]
types.should.equal([
"WorkflowExecutionStarted",
"DecisionTaskScheduled",
"DecisionTaskStarted",
"DecisionTaskCompleted",
])
evt = resp["events"][-1]
evt["decisionTaskCompletedEventAttributes"].should.equal({
"scheduledEventId": 2,
"startedEventId": 3,
})
@mock_swf
def test_respond_decision_task_completed_with_wrong_token():
conn = setup_workflow()
resp = conn.poll_for_decision_task("test-domain", "queue")
conn.respond_decision_task_completed.when.called_with(
"not-a-correct-token"
).should.throw(SWFValidationException)
@mock_swf
def test_respond_decision_task_completed_on_close_workflow_execution():
conn = setup_workflow()
resp = conn.poll_for_decision_task("test-domain", "queue")
task_token = resp["taskToken"]
# bad: we're closing workflow execution manually, but endpoints are not coded for now..
wfe = swf_backend.domains[0].workflow_executions.values()[0]
wfe.execution_status = "CLOSED"
# /bad
conn.respond_decision_task_completed.when.called_with(
task_token
).should.throw(SWFUnknownResourceFault)
@mock_swf
def test_respond_decision_task_completed_with_task_already_completed():
conn = setup_workflow()
resp = conn.poll_for_decision_task("test-domain", "queue")
task_token = resp["taskToken"]
conn.respond_decision_task_completed(task_token)
conn.respond_decision_task_completed.when.called_with(
task_token
).should.throw(SWFUnknownResourceFault)
@mock_swf
def test_respond_decision_task_completed_with_complete_workflow_execution():
conn = setup_workflow()
resp = conn.poll_for_decision_task("test-domain", "queue")
task_token = resp["taskToken"]
decisions = [{
"decisionType": "CompleteWorkflowExecution",
"completeWorkflowExecutionDecisionAttributes": {"result": "foo bar"}
}]
resp = conn.respond_decision_task_completed(task_token, decisions=decisions)
resp.should.be.none
resp = conn.get_workflow_execution_history("test-domain", conn.run_id, "uid-abcd1234")
types = [evt["eventType"] for evt in resp["events"]]
types.should.equal([
"WorkflowExecutionStarted",
"DecisionTaskScheduled",
"DecisionTaskStarted",
"DecisionTaskCompleted",
"WorkflowExecutionCompleted",
])
resp["events"][-1]["workflowExecutionCompletedEventAttributes"]["result"].should.equal("foo bar")
@mock_swf
def test_respond_decision_task_completed_with_close_decision_not_last():
conn = setup_workflow()
resp = conn.poll_for_decision_task("test-domain", "queue")
task_token = resp["taskToken"]
decisions = [
{ "decisionType": "CompleteWorkflowExecution" },
{ "decisionType": "WeDontCare" },
]
conn.respond_decision_task_completed.when.called_with(
task_token, decisions=decisions
).should.throw(SWFValidationException, r"Close must be last decision in list")
@mock_swf
def test_respond_decision_task_completed_with_invalid_decision_type():
conn = setup_workflow()
resp = conn.poll_for_decision_task("test-domain", "queue")
task_token = resp["taskToken"]
decisions = [
{ "decisionType": "BadDecisionType" },
{ "decisionType": "CompleteWorkflowExecution" },
]
conn.respond_decision_task_completed.when.called_with(
task_token, decisions=decisions
).should.throw(
SWFDecisionValidationException,
r"Value 'BadDecisionType' at 'decisions.1.member.decisionType'"
)
@mock_swf
def test_respond_decision_task_completed_with_missing_attributes():
conn = setup_workflow()
resp = conn.poll_for_decision_task("test-domain", "queue")
task_token = resp["taskToken"]
decisions = [
{
"decisionType": "should trigger even with incorrect decision type",
"startTimerDecisionAttributes": {}
},
]
conn.respond_decision_task_completed.when.called_with(
task_token, decisions=decisions
).should.throw(
SWFDecisionValidationException,
r"Value null at 'decisions.1.member.startTimerDecisionAttributes.timerId' " \
r"failed to satisfy constraint: Member must not be null"
)
@mock_swf
def test_respond_decision_task_completed_with_missing_attributes_totally():
conn = setup_workflow()
resp = conn.poll_for_decision_task("test-domain", "queue")
task_token = resp["taskToken"]
decisions = [
{ "decisionType": "StartTimer" },
]
conn.respond_decision_task_completed.when.called_with(
task_token, decisions=decisions
).should.throw(
SWFDecisionValidationException,
r"Value null at 'decisions.1.member.startTimerDecisionAttributes.timerId' " \
r"failed to satisfy constraint: Member must not be null"
)
@mock_swf
def test_respond_decision_task_completed_with_fail_workflow_execution():
conn = setup_workflow()
resp = conn.poll_for_decision_task("test-domain", "queue")
task_token = resp["taskToken"]
decisions = [{
"decisionType": "FailWorkflowExecution",
"failWorkflowExecutionDecisionAttributes": {"reason": "my rules", "details": "foo"}
}]
resp = conn.respond_decision_task_completed(task_token, decisions=decisions)
resp.should.be.none
resp = conn.get_workflow_execution_history("test-domain", conn.run_id, "uid-abcd1234")
types = [evt["eventType"] for evt in resp["events"]]
types.should.equal([
"WorkflowExecutionStarted",
"DecisionTaskScheduled",
"DecisionTaskStarted",
"DecisionTaskCompleted",
"WorkflowExecutionFailed",
])
attrs = resp["events"][-1]["workflowExecutionFailedEventAttributes"]
attrs["reason"].should.equal("my rules")
attrs["details"].should.equal("foo")
@mock_swf
def test_respond_decision_task_completed_with_schedule_activity_task():
conn = setup_workflow()
resp = conn.poll_for_decision_task("test-domain", "queue")
task_token = resp["taskToken"]
decisions = [{
"decisionType": "ScheduleActivityTask",
"scheduleActivityTaskDecisionAttributes": {
"activityId": "my-activity-001",
"activityType": {
"name": "test-activity",
"version": "v1.1"
},
"heartbeatTimeout": "60",
"input": "123",
"taskList": {
"name": "my-task-list"
},
}
}]
resp = conn.respond_decision_task_completed(task_token, decisions=decisions)
resp.should.be.none
resp = conn.get_workflow_execution_history("test-domain", conn.run_id, "uid-abcd1234")
types = [evt["eventType"] for evt in resp["events"]]
types.should.equal([
"WorkflowExecutionStarted",
"DecisionTaskScheduled",
"DecisionTaskStarted",
"DecisionTaskCompleted",
"ActivityTaskScheduled",
])
resp["events"][-1]["activityTaskScheduledEventAttributes"].should.equal({
"decisionTaskCompletedEventId": 4,
"activityId": "my-activity-001",
"activityType": {
"name": "test-activity",
"version": "v1.1",
},
"heartbeatTimeout": "60",
"input": "123",
"taskList": {
"name": "my-task-list"
},
})

import boto
from sure import expect
from moto import mock_swf
from moto.swf.exceptions import (
SWFUnknownResourceFault,
SWFDomainAlreadyExistsFault,
SWFDomainDeprecatedFault,
SWFSerializationException,
)
# RegisterDomain endpoint
@mock_swf
def test_register_domain():
conn = boto.connect_swf("the_key", "the_secret")
conn.register_domain("test-domain", "60", description="A test domain")
all_domains = conn.list_domains("REGISTERED")
domain = all_domains["domainInfos"][0]
domain["name"].should.equal("test-domain")
domain["status"].should.equal("REGISTERED")
domain["description"].should.equal("A test domain")
@mock_swf
def test_register_already_existing_domain():
conn = boto.connect_swf("the_key", "the_secret")
conn.register_domain("test-domain", "60", description="A test domain")
conn.register_domain.when.called_with(
"test-domain", "60", description="A test domain"
).should.throw(SWFDomainAlreadyExistsFault)
@mock_swf
def test_register_with_wrong_parameter_type():
conn = boto.connect_swf("the_key", "the_secret")
conn.register_domain.when.called_with(
"test-domain", 60, description="A test domain"
).should.throw(SWFSerializationException)
# ListDomains endpoint
@mock_swf
def test_list_domains_order():
conn = boto.connect_swf("the_key", "the_secret")
conn.register_domain("b-test-domain", "60")
conn.register_domain("a-test-domain", "60")
conn.register_domain("c-test-domain", "60")
all_domains = conn.list_domains("REGISTERED")
names = [domain["name"] for domain in all_domains["domainInfos"]]
names.should.equal(["a-test-domain", "b-test-domain", "c-test-domain"])
@mock_swf
def test_list_domains_reverse_order():
conn = boto.connect_swf("the_key", "the_secret")
conn.register_domain("b-test-domain", "60")
conn.register_domain("a-test-domain", "60")
conn.register_domain("c-test-domain", "60")
all_domains = conn.list_domains("REGISTERED", reverse_order=True)
names = [domain["name"] for domain in all_domains["domainInfos"]]
names.should.equal(["c-test-domain", "b-test-domain", "a-test-domain"])
# DeprecateDomain endpoint
@mock_swf
def test_deprecate_domain():
conn = boto.connect_swf("the_key", "the_secret")
conn.register_domain("test-domain", "60", description="A test domain")
conn.deprecate_domain("test-domain")
all_domains = conn.list_domains("DEPRECATED")
domain = all_domains["domainInfos"][0]
domain["name"].should.equal("test-domain")
@mock_swf
def test_deprecate_already_deprecated_domain():
conn = boto.connect_swf("the_key", "the_secret")
conn.register_domain("test-domain", "60", description="A test domain")
conn.deprecate_domain("test-domain")
conn.deprecate_domain.when.called_with(
"test-domain"
).should.throw(SWFDomainDeprecatedFault)
@mock_swf
def test_deprecate_non_existent_domain():
conn = boto.connect_swf("the_key", "the_secret")
conn.deprecate_domain.when.called_with(
"non-existent"
).should.throw(SWFUnknownResourceFault)
# DescribeDomain endpoint
@mock_swf
def test_describe_domain():
conn = boto.connect_swf("the_key", "the_secret")
conn.register_domain("test-domain", "60", description="A test domain")
domain = conn.describe_domain("test-domain")
domain["configuration"]["workflowExecutionRetentionPeriodInDays"].should.equal("60")
domain["domainInfo"]["description"].should.equal("A test domain")
domain["domainInfo"]["name"].should.equal("test-domain")
domain["domainInfo"]["status"].should.equal("REGISTERED")
@mock_swf
def test_describe_non_existent_domain():
conn = boto.connect_swf("the_key", "the_secret")
conn.describe_domain.when.called_with(
"non-existent"
).should.throw(SWFUnknownResourceFault)

import boto
from sure import expect
from moto import mock_swf
from moto.swf.exceptions import (
SWFWorkflowExecutionAlreadyStartedFault,
SWFTypeDeprecatedFault,
SWFUnknownResourceFault,
)
# Utils
@mock_swf
def setup_swf_environment():
conn = boto.connect_swf("the_key", "the_secret")
conn.register_domain("test-domain", "60", description="A test domain")
conn.register_workflow_type(
"test-domain", "test-workflow", "v1.0",
task_list="queue", default_child_policy="TERMINATE",
default_execution_start_to_close_timeout="300",
default_task_start_to_close_timeout="300",
)
conn.register_activity_type("test-domain", "test-activity", "v1.1")
return conn
# StartWorkflowExecution endpoint
@mock_swf
def test_start_workflow_execution():
conn = setup_swf_environment()
wf = conn.start_workflow_execution("test-domain", "uid-abcd1234", "test-workflow", "v1.0")
wf.should.contain("runId")
@mock_swf
def test_start_already_started_workflow_execution():
conn = setup_swf_environment()
conn.start_workflow_execution("test-domain", "uid-abcd1234", "test-workflow", "v1.0")
conn.start_workflow_execution.when.called_with(
"test-domain", "uid-abcd1234", "test-workflow", "v1.0"
).should.throw(SWFWorkflowExecutionAlreadyStartedFault)
@mock_swf
def test_start_workflow_execution_on_deprecated_type():
conn = setup_swf_environment()
conn.deprecate_workflow_type("test-domain", "test-workflow", "v1.0")
conn.start_workflow_execution.when.called_with(
"test-domain", "uid-abcd1234", "test-workflow", "v1.0"
).should.throw(SWFTypeDeprecatedFault)
# DescribeWorkflowExecution endpoint
@mock_swf
def test_describe_workflow_execution():
conn = setup_swf_environment()
hsh = conn.start_workflow_execution("test-domain", "uid-abcd1234", "test-workflow", "v1.0")
run_id = hsh["runId"]
wfe = conn.describe_workflow_execution("test-domain", run_id, "uid-abcd1234")
wfe["executionInfo"]["execution"]["workflowId"].should.equal("uid-abcd1234")
wfe["executionInfo"]["executionStatus"].should.equal("OPEN")
@mock_swf
def test_describe_non_existent_workflow_execution():
conn = setup_swf_environment()
conn.describe_workflow_execution.when.called_with(
"test-domain", "wrong-run-id", "wrong-workflow-id"
).should.throw(SWFUnknownResourceFault)
# GetWorkflowExecutionHistory endpoint
@mock_swf
def test_get_workflow_execution_history():
conn = setup_swf_environment()
hsh = conn.start_workflow_execution("test-domain", "uid-abcd1234", "test-workflow", "v1.0")
run_id = hsh["runId"]
resp = conn.get_workflow_execution_history("test-domain", run_id, "uid-abcd1234")
types = [evt["eventType"] for evt in resp["events"]]
types.should.equal(["WorkflowExecutionStarted", "DecisionTaskScheduled"])
@mock_swf
def test_get_workflow_execution_history_with_reverse_order():
conn = setup_swf_environment()
hsh = conn.start_workflow_execution("test-domain", "uid-abcd1234", "test-workflow", "v1.0")
run_id = hsh["runId"]
resp = conn.get_workflow_execution_history("test-domain", run_id, "uid-abcd1234",
reverse_order=True)
types = [evt["eventType"] for evt in resp["events"]]
types.should.equal(["DecisionTaskScheduled", "WorkflowExecutionStarted"])
@mock_swf
def test_get_workflow_execution_history_on_non_existent_workflow_execution():
conn = setup_swf_environment()
conn.get_workflow_execution_history.when.called_with(
"test-domain", "wrong-run-id", "wrong-workflow-id"
).should.throw(SWFUnknownResourceFault)

import boto
from sure import expect
from moto import mock_swf
from moto.swf.exceptions import (
SWFUnknownResourceFault,
SWFTypeAlreadyExistsFault,
SWFTypeDeprecatedFault,
SWFSerializationException,
)
# RegisterWorkflowType endpoint
@mock_swf
def test_register_workflow_type():
conn = boto.connect_swf("the_key", "the_secret")
conn.register_domain("test-domain", "60")
conn.register_workflow_type("test-domain", "test-workflow", "v1.0")
types = conn.list_workflow_types("test-domain", "REGISTERED")
actype = types["typeInfos"][0]
actype["workflowType"]["name"].should.equal("test-workflow")
actype["workflowType"]["version"].should.equal("v1.0")
@mock_swf
def test_register_already_existing_workflow_type():
conn = boto.connect_swf("the_key", "the_secret")
conn.register_domain("test-domain", "60")
conn.register_workflow_type("test-domain", "test-workflow", "v1.0")
conn.register_workflow_type.when.called_with(
"test-domain", "test-workflow", "v1.0"
).should.throw(SWFTypeAlreadyExistsFault)
@mock_swf
def test_register_with_wrong_parameter_type():
conn = boto.connect_swf("the_key", "the_secret")
conn.register_domain("test-domain", "60")
conn.register_workflow_type.when.called_with(
"test-domain", "test-workflow", 12
).should.throw(SWFSerializationException)
# ListWorkflowTypes endpoint
@mock_swf
def test_list_workflow_types():
conn = boto.connect_swf("the_key", "the_secret")
conn.register_domain("test-domain", "60")
conn.register_workflow_type("test-domain", "b-test-workflow", "v1.0")
conn.register_workflow_type("test-domain", "a-test-workflow", "v1.0")
conn.register_workflow_type("test-domain", "c-test-workflow", "v1.0")
all_workflow_types = conn.list_workflow_types("test-domain", "REGISTERED")
names = [activity_type["workflowType"]["name"] for activity_type in all_workflow_types["typeInfos"]]
names.should.equal(["a-test-workflow", "b-test-workflow", "c-test-workflow"])
@mock_swf
def test_list_workflow_types_reverse_order():
conn = boto.connect_swf("the_key", "the_secret")
conn.register_domain("test-domain", "60")
conn.register_workflow_type("test-domain", "b-test-workflow", "v1.0")
conn.register_workflow_type("test-domain", "a-test-workflow", "v1.0")
conn.register_workflow_type("test-domain", "c-test-workflow", "v1.0")
all_workflow_types = conn.list_workflow_types("test-domain", "REGISTERED",
reverse_order=True)
names = [activity_type["workflowType"]["name"] for activity_type in all_workflow_types["typeInfos"]]
names.should.equal(["c-test-workflow", "b-test-workflow", "a-test-workflow"])
# DeprecateWorkflowType endpoint
@mock_swf
def test_deprecate_workflow_type():
conn = boto.connect_swf("the_key", "the_secret")
conn.register_domain("test-domain", "60")
conn.register_workflow_type("test-domain", "test-workflow", "v1.0")
conn.deprecate_workflow_type("test-domain", "test-workflow", "v1.0")
actypes = conn.list_workflow_types("test-domain", "DEPRECATED")
actype = actypes["typeInfos"][0]
actype["workflowType"]["name"].should.equal("test-workflow")
actype["workflowType"]["version"].should.equal("v1.0")
@mock_swf
def test_deprecate_already_deprecated_workflow_type():
conn = boto.connect_swf("the_key", "the_secret")
conn.register_domain("test-domain", "60")
conn.register_workflow_type("test-domain", "test-workflow", "v1.0")
conn.deprecate_workflow_type("test-domain", "test-workflow", "v1.0")
conn.deprecate_workflow_type.when.called_with(
"test-domain", "test-workflow", "v1.0"
).should.throw(SWFTypeDeprecatedFault)
@mock_swf
def test_deprecate_non_existent_workflow_type():
conn = boto.connect_swf("the_key", "the_secret")
conn.register_domain("test-domain", "60")
conn.deprecate_workflow_type.when.called_with(
"test-domain", "non-existent", "v1.0"
).should.throw(SWFUnknownResourceFault)
# DescribeWorkflowType endpoint
@mock_swf
def test_describe_workflow_type():
conn = boto.connect_swf("the_key", "the_secret")
conn.register_domain("test-domain", "60")
conn.register_workflow_type("test-domain", "test-workflow", "v1.0",
task_list="foo", default_child_policy="TERMINATE")
actype = conn.describe_workflow_type("test-domain", "test-workflow", "v1.0")
actype["configuration"]["defaultTaskList"]["name"].should.equal("foo")
actype["configuration"]["defaultChildPolicy"].should.equal("TERMINATE")
actype["configuration"].keys().should_not.contain("defaultTaskStartToCloseTimeout")
infos = actype["typeInfo"]
infos["workflowType"]["name"].should.equal("test-workflow")
infos["workflowType"]["version"].should.equal("v1.0")
infos["status"].should.equal("REGISTERED")
@mock_swf
def test_describe_non_existent_workflow_type():
conn = boto.connect_swf("the_key", "the_secret")
conn.register_domain("test-domain", "60")
conn.describe_workflow_type.when.called_with(
"test-domain", "non-existent", "v1.0"
).should.throw(SWFUnknownResourceFault)
